How to Make English Muffin Pizza in the Oven
Making English muffin pizza in the oven is a straightforward process.
Start by preheating your oven to 375°F (190°C).
This temperature ensures that the muffins become golden brown and crispy while the cheese melts perfectly.
Split the English muffins in half and arrange them cut side up on a baking sheet.
For an extra layer of flavor, consider brushing the tops with olive oil before adding your toppings.

Can You Freeze English Muffins?
If you find yourself with leftover English muffins, you might wonder, can English muffins be frozen?
The answer is yes!
You can freeze them for later use, making it easy to whip up mini pizzas whenever the craving strikes.
Simply store the split muffins in an airtight container or freezer bag.
When you’re ready to enjoy them, just pop them in the oven, and you’ll have delicious mini pizzas ready in no time!

Easy English Muffin Pizza Recipe
This recipe features toasted English muffins topped with marinara sauce, cheese, and various toppings of your choice. It takes about 20 minutes from start to finish and serves 4 people. You can experiment with different combinations to create your ideal breakfast pizza English muffins.
Ingredients
- 4 English muffins, split in half
- 1 cup marinara sauce or pizza sauce
- 1 1/2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1/2 cup sliced pepperoni or other toppings of choice
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- Olive oil for brushing (optional)
- Fresh basil or parsley for garnish (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Prepare the Muffins: Split the English muffins in half and place them cut side up on a baking sheet. Optionally, brush the tops with olive oil for extra crispiness.
- Add Sauce: Spoon marinara sauce evenly over each muffin half.
- Top with Cheese: S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ese on top of the sauce, then add your desired toppings such as pepperoni or vegetables.
- Season: Sprinkle Italian seasoning over the top for added flavor.
- Bake: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ake for about 10-12 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Serve: Remove from the oven, let cool slightly, and garnish with fresh basil or parsley if desired. Serve hot.
Cook and Prep Times
- Prep Time: 5 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
- Total Time: 20 minutes
